You Get Grok-4-Fast: Search Smarter, Spend Way Less

Quick Summary:
You’ve seen models that separate “thinking” tasks (reasoning) from quick ones (non-reasoning). Grok-4-Fast unites both in one model with a 2 million-token context, so you can ask complex, long tasks without switching tools. It uses reinforcement learning so it knows when to browse, code, or call tools, making things faster and cheaper.

Key Insights:

  • It uses one unified set of weights for reasoning and non-reasoning, controlled by system prompts. No switching models.

  • Offers a 2,000,000 token context window—you get long context handling for huge documents or long chats.

  • Trained with tool-use reinforcement learning: decides itself when to browse the web, run code, or call external tools.

  • On benchmarks, it matches or nearly matches Grok-4 but uses ~40% fewer “thinking” tokens, cutting your cost dramatically.

  • API costs are laid out: input and output token rates vary depending on context size, with lower rates for smaller contexts and caching.

You Now Own Apple’s AI Power Move 

Quick Summary:
You’re seeing Apple pull ahead: with the A19 Pro, it now fully controls all core iPhone chips. That means Apple has built neural accelerators into the GPU cores and is phasing out outside suppliers like Broadcom and Qualcomm. The goal? To make your iPhone super smart and fast, especially for AI tasks, while saving battery and boosting raw performance.

Key Insights:

  • Apple’s A19 Pro integrates neural accelerators directly into each GPU core. You get AI processing and graphics in the same spot.

  • Apple built its own wireless chip (N1) and a second-generation modem (C1X) to cut down dependency on Broadcom and Qualcomm.

  • The new designs aim for performance like a MacBook Pro, but in your iPhone. Expect faster AI features with lower power use.

  • Apple wants to control the full chip stack ‒ workload mapping, power management, privacy all in their hands. That helps them tune things better than when relying on others.

You Can Now Use Meta’s Llama for US Federal Work

Quick Summary:
You’ll see Meta’s AI model Llama now cleared for use by U.S. government agencies. The General Services Administration (GSA) approved it after confirming it meets legal and security rules. This means agencies can use Llama—for example, to speed up contract reviews or fix IT issues with less delay.

Key Insights:

  • The GSA, the U.S. government’s procurement office, added Llama to its approved tech tools list.

  • Llama can process text, video, images, audio—so you’re not limited in how you use it.

  • It is free to use for agencies, with GSA assuring it passes security and legal checks.

  • Other AI tools from AWS, Microsoft, Google, Anthropic, and OpenAI were already approved under similar terms.

  • Use cases include contract reviews, resolving IT problems, and other administrative tasks.

How to Connect Lovable with n8n - Step-by-Step (2025)

Quick Summary:

You’ll see how to connect Lovable with N8N using a webhook. This lets you trigger automations from a contact form without coding or a native integration. The setup takes only a few clicks and opens up endless automation options.

Key Insights:

  • In N8N, create a Webhook step, set it to POST, and copy the URL.

  • In Lovable, edit the Send Message button on your contact form.

  • Paste the webhook URL into Lovable so button clicks trigger N8N.

  • You can then build workflows like notifications, database entries, or custom automations.

  • Researchers at the University of Sheffield found that tiny bee brains use flight movements to sharpen visual signal processing. A digital model shows that movement-based perception could let future AI or robots recognize complex patterns efficiently—without huge compute demands. You may see lighter, faster AI systems inspired by insects sooner than you think.

  • MIT researchers introduced a tool called SCIGEN, which steers generative AI to design quantum-materials by enforcing design rules. Instead of random material proposals, SCIGEN produces candidates with exotic properties like superconductivity. You could see breakthroughs in electronics, magnets, optics sooner because fewer useless samples will be generated.
